An insight into Weight Reduction Surgery

Diabetes and obesity are the two major epidemics threatening the well-being and health of billions of individuals across the planet. Because of this uncontrollable rise of the above two conditions, weight reduction surgery popularly known as bariatric surgery, has taken an important place in the medical fraternity. Bariatric surgery is at present, one of the most efficient surgery therapies wherein the average long-term loss of weight is 15%. As a result, bariatric surgery has gained significant interest as future treatment for diabetic patients too.



Obesity has become a daunting problem among individuals and while healthy lifestyle and exercise can provide relief, but only to a certain extent. As such, doctors as well as medical practitioners are now focusing on numerous treatment protocols for combating weigh reduction as well as various related lifestyle diseases. 

Weight-loss surgery procedures are specifically done to reduce fat among highly obese people, and focuses on the abdomen and stomach areas. The official recommendation for undergoing bariatric surgery is when a patient’s Body Mass Index (BMI) is more than 40.

Weight-reduction procedures for surgery can take in various forms. Opens surgeries are rarely done now-a-days as the risk is high. The most common surgery is method is laparoscopic surgery. However, researchers are also hoping to advance the surgery procedures from laparoscopic to endoscopic in near future. Malabsorptive surgery procedures are done to reduce the size of the stomach and its effectiveness depends on the condition of the malabsorption. Other forms of malabsorbtive procedures are biliopancreatic diversion and endoluminal sleeve. At the same time, some of the restrictive procedures include vertical gastroplast, gastric band, sleeve gastrostomy, gastric balloon.

The most common bariatric surgery followed is (gastric) bypass surgery involving both technologies. Bariatric surgery costs are determined by the procedure type. However, they can also vary depending on the surgical practice, geography as well as hospital category. 

Weight reduction surgeries help in positive metabolism manipulation of patients. Reports on post-weight reduction surgeries have found development in blood chemistry as well other conditions like high cholesterol, diabetes and hypertension. As a result, weight reduction surgeries are being look upon as a potential future treatment for diabetes too.

5 Gems of Art Gallery in India

Indian Art Gallery is one of the most prominent portals that highlights the culture of India. Every year, thousands of foreigners along with millions of natives visit art galleries to unfold some of the best paintings in the world. The category includes Modernism, Impressionism, Abstract, Expressionism, Surrealism and many more. Art Gallery in India offers an insight into numerous styles of paintings and some of the most celebrated painters of India are as follows:'

1) MF Husain


MaqboolFida Husain lived from 17 September, 1915 to 9 June, 2011. Started his career with Indian Modernism in the 1940s. Some his best works are Between the Spider & the Lamp, Mother India, Bharat Mata, GajaGamini and Maiden’s Fight

2) Ravi Varma


Ravi Varma was one of the greatest Indian painters who lived from 29 April, 1848 to 2 October, 1906. Most of his paintings were inspired by European Academic art and reflected a real-life portrait.  His most famous paintings were on Indian Gods such as Baby Krishna, Saraswati, etc.
 
3) Bhupen Khakhar


BhupenKhakhar lived from March 10, 1934 to August 8, 2003. He was one of the pioneers of Indian Contemporary Art. Some of  his most famous paintings are Gallery of Rogues, Manchester Cotton Mills, Two Men With a Flower and Man with Plastic Flowers.
 
4) Akbar Padamsee


Akbar Padamsee was born on April 12, 1928 and is one of the best Modern Indian Painter. Some of his well known works are Nude, Mirror Image, Cityscape, Portrait of Husain and Paysage aux toits.
 
5) Aditya Basak


Aditya Basak was born on March 14, 1953. He is one of the fastest growing name in India with his popular works. Though most of his paintings are untitled, he has received a National Award in 1986.
